Arthandor: a magical realm of floating continents, glowing mists, and ancient ruins


Author's Note: A mystical world where sprawling continents float above vast seas of shimmering mist, Arthandor is a realm where magic weaves through the air like threads of light, shaping the lives of its denizens. It is a land of ancient kingdoms, enigmatic ruins, and untamed wilderness where legends come alive and destiny awaits.

Vorpal Sword
Vorpal Sword
Weapon
Details
TypeWeapon
CategoryMartial Melee Weapons
RarityLegendary
Weight3.00 lb.
Cost0 Gold Pieces
Description

You gain a +3 bonus to attack and damage rolls made with this magic weapon. In addition, the weapon ignores resistance to slashing damage. When you attack a creature that has at least one head with this weapon and roll a 20 on the attack roll, you cut off one of the creature's heads. The creature dies if it can't survive without the lost head. A creature is immune to this effect if it is immune to slashing damage, doesn't have or need a head, has legendary actions, or the GM decides that the creature is too big for its head to be cut off with this weapon. Such a creature instead takes an extra 6d8 slashing damage from the hit.
